The Most Essential Yacht Accessories for Exploring Italy’s Beautiful Coast

Exploring Italy’s stunning coastline is a dream for many sailing enthusiasts, but making the most of your trip requires the right yacht accessories. Whether you’re sailing from the Amalfi Coast to the islands of Sicily, equipping your yacht with essential tools and comfort items can enhance your experience significantly. Here are the most essential yacht accessories for exploring Italy’s beautiful coast.

1. High-Quality Navigation System
A reliable navigation system is a must-have for any yacht trip. Equip your vessel with a top-tier GPS device and chart plotter to ensure you never lose your way while sailing through Italy’s breathtaking coastline. Consider using marine navigation apps that provide real-time updates to keep you informed of any weather changes or navigational challenges.

2. Safety Gear
Safety should always come first when sailing. Ensure you have a complete set of safety gear on board, including life jackets, flares, a first aid kit, and fire extinguishers. It's essential to comply with local regulations and be prepared for any emergencies that may arise while exploring the coast.

5. Snorkeling and Watersports Equipment
Italy’s coastline is teeming with marine life, making snorkeling gear essential. Bring along wetsuits, masks, and snorkels to explore the underwater beauty. Consider adding kayaks or paddleboards for added adventure in secluded coves and clear waters.

6. Cooking and Dining Supplies
Make the most of local markets by bringing along cooking supplies. Stock your yacht with a portable grill, utensils, and dishware to prepare fresh Mediterranean meals. A good cooler will keep drinks chilled during your sailing trips, ensuring you stay refreshed throughout the day.

7. Fishing Gear
Fishing is a popular pastime along the Italian coast. If you’re interested in catching some local fish, be sure to bring your fishing gear. Follow local regulations regarding fishing and consider packing a small cookout grill to prepare your catch right on board.

9. Communication Devices
Keeping in touch while sailing is essential. Equip your yacht with a VHF radio and a satellite phone for emergency situations. A reliable mobile phone plan will also help you share your adventures with friends and family back home.
